新聞中心
搭建穩(wěn)定快速的yum源服務器,需要選擇合適的操作系統(tǒng)、軟件包和存儲設備,并定期更新和維護。還需要優(yōu)化網(wǎng)絡連接和緩存機制。
打造穩(wěn)定快速的yum源服務器

準備工作
1、確定操作系統(tǒng):選擇適合的操作系統(tǒng)作為yum源服務器,如CentOS、Ubuntu等。
2、硬件配置:確保服務器具備足夠的內(nèi)存和存儲空間,以支持多用戶同時訪問。
3、網(wǎng)絡連接:保證服務器與互聯(lián)網(wǎng)的穩(wěn)定連接,以便下載軟件包。
4、安裝必要的軟件:在服務器上安裝Apache Web服務器和MySQL數(shù)據(jù)庫。
搭建Apache Web服務器
1、更新系統(tǒng)軟件包:運行以下命令更新系統(tǒng)軟件包列表。
```
sudo yum update
```
2、安裝Apache Web服務器:運行以下命令安裝Apache Web服務器。
```
sudo yum install httpd
```
3、啟動并設置開機自啟動Apache服務:運行以下命令啟動Apache服務,并設置為開機自啟動。
```
sudo systemctl start httpd
sudo systemctl enable httpd
```
4、配置防火墻規(guī)則:開放HTTP和HTTPS端口(默認為80和443)。
```
sudo firewall-cmd --permanent --add-service=http
sudo firewall-cmd --permanent --add-service=https
sudo firewall-cmd --reload
```
5、創(chuàng)建虛擬主機配置文件:在Apache的主配置文件中添加虛擬主機配置信息。
```
sudo vi /etc/httpd/conf.d/virtual.conf
```
6、編輯虛擬主機配置文件:在文件中添加以下內(nèi)容,并根據(jù)實際情況修改相應的路徑和域名。
```
ServerName yourdomain.com
DocumentRoot /var/www/html/yourdomain.com/public_html
ErrorLog /var/www/html/yourdomain.com/logs/error_log
CustomLog /var/www/html/yourdomain.com/logs/access_log combined
```
7、重啟Apache服務:運行以下命令重啟Apache服務,使配置生效。
```
sudo systemctl restart httpd
```
搭建MySQL數(shù)據(jù)庫服務器
1、安裝MySQL數(shù)據(jù)庫服務器:運行以下命令安裝MySQL數(shù)據(jù)庫服務器。
```
sudo yum install mysql-server mysql-client
```
2、啟動并設置開機自啟動MySQL服務:運行以下命令啟動MySQL服務,并設置為開機自啟動。
```
sudo systemctl start mysqld
sudo systemctl enable mysqld
```
3、安全加固MySQL服務器:運行以下命令進行安全加固,包括設置強密碼、刪除匿名用戶等。
```
sudo mysql_secure_installation
```
4、創(chuàng)建yum源數(shù)據(jù)庫和用戶:運行以下命令創(chuàng)建yum源數(shù)據(jù)庫和用戶,并設置密碼。
```
sudo mysql -u root -p create yumrepo; CREATE USER 'yumrepo'@'localhost' IDENTIFIED BY 'password'; GRANT ALL PRIVILEGES ON yumrepo.* TO 'yumrepo'@'localhost'; FLUSH PRIVILEGES; exit;
```
5、導入yum源數(shù)據(jù):將準備好的yum源數(shù)據(jù)導入到數(shù)據(jù)庫中,可以使用工具如mysqlimport或直接使用SQL語句導入,使用以下命令導入數(shù)據(jù)文件yumrepo.sql。
```
mysql -u yumrepo -p yumrepo < yumrepo.sql
```
6、配置Apache Web服務器訪問MySQL數(shù)據(jù)庫:在Apache的主配置文件中添加對MySQL的訪問配置,在virtual.conf文件中添加以下內(nèi)容。
```
LoadModule dbd_mysql.so
AddHandler dbd_mysql php5-mysqli.so
Action application/x-httpd-php /phpmyadmin/index.php/db_name=yumrepo&table=yourtable&action=select&id=%s&token=%s&form_id=%s&form_token=%s&submit=Go+%s&limitstart=%s&limitend=%s&sortby=%s&sortorder=%s&filter=%s&filter_value=%s&filter_operator=%s&filter_exact=%s&filter_andor=%s&filter_field=%s&filter_field_op=%s&filter_field_exact=%s&filter_field_andor=%s&filter_field_value=%s&filter_field_value_op=%s&filter_field_value_exact=%s&filter_field_value_andor=%s&filter_field_value_like=%s&filter_field_value_likeop=%s&filter_field_value_likeexact=%s&filter_field_value_likeandor=%s&filter_field_value_likeregexp=%s&filter_field_value_likeregexpop=%s&filter_field_value_likeregexpexact=%s&filter_field_value_likeregexpandor=%s&filter_field_value_likeregexplike=%s&filter_field_value_likeregexplexact=%s&filter_field_value_likeregexplexandor=%s&filter_field_value_likeregexplexlike=%s&filter_field_value_likeregexplexlikeop=%s&filter_field_value_likeregexplexlikeexact=%s&filter_field = %s&filter = %s&action = %s&id = %s&token = %s&form id = %s&form token = %s&submit = Go + %s&limitstart = %s&limitend = %s&sortby = %s&sortorder = %s&filter = %s&filter value = %s&filter operator = %s&filter exact = %s&filter andor = %s&filter field = %s&filter field op = %s&filter field exact = %s&filter field andor = %s&filter field value = %s&filter field value op = %s&filter field value exact = %s&filter field value andor = %s&filter field value like = %s&filter field value likeop = %s&filter field value likeexact = %s&filter field value likeandor = %s&filter field value likeregexp = %s&filter field value likeregexpop = %s&filter field value likeregexpexact = %s&filter field value likeregexpandor = %s&filter field value likeregexplike = %s&filter field value likeregexplexact = %s&filter field value likeregexplexandor = %s&filter field value likeregexplexlike = %s&action = &id = &token = &form id = &form token = &submit = Go + &limitstart = &limitend = &sortby = &sortorder = &filter = &filter value = &filter operator = &filter exact = &filter andor = &filter field = &filter field op = &filter field exact = &filter field andor = &filter field value = &filter field value op = &filter field value exact = &filter field value andor = &filter field value like = &filter field value likeop = &filter field value likeexact = &filter field value likeandor = &filter field value likeregexp = &filter field value likeregexpop = &filter field value likeregexpexact = &filter field value likeregexpandor = &filter field value likeregexplike = &filter field value likeregexplexact = &filter field value likeregexplexandor = &filter field value likeregexplexlike
分享標題:打造穩(wěn)定快速的yum源服務器(yum源服務器)
當前URL:http://www.dlmjj.cn/article/ccieecd.html


咨詢
建站咨詢
